Due to the multiple leaks that have been arriving for months, there remains very little information that we don’t know about the Galaxy Unpacked event that Samsung will celebrate on August 5. One of the expected is the Samsung Galaxy Z Flip 5G, which now comes confirmed in a video.
It will be the variant with support for the new 5G broadband network and although it will follow the concept of the first generation it will offer some new features. Everything indicates that it will be slightly larger, it will keep the compact size and the “shell” design with which Samsung wanted to go back to the origins to boost its new generation of folding.
Considering 5G support, the biggest changes will come from within. While the first model has a Snapdragon 855 Plus SoC, the Z Flip could include the latest from Qualcomm, the Snapdragon 865 Plus presented last week and which will become the most powerful mobile chipset that can be mounted on smartphones for the last months remained of the year.
Its screen will be a flexible OLED with support for HDR10 + protected by an “ultra-thin glass”, compared to typical polycarbonate, which should considerably strengthen the panel, so that it will improve in resistance and robustness. This cover is believed to be used in the Fold 2 as well, another device that will be presented at the August event.
We don’t believe that there are any significant changes to the camera system, while the presence of a small notification screen and the independent hinge that makes it so unique, similar to models like the Moto Razr, and that allows perfect handling both folded and unfolded.

Samsung Galaxy Z Flip 5G will be available in three colors (gold, black and purple), as we see in the video. There are no details of the price, but considering that the previous model cost $ 1,500, we will probably have to pay a little more to get this model with 5G.
